Question 95 850 drivers side front axel stuck

i have the axel to the point where i can move it out less then 1/2 inch then its stuck wont come further. if i push it back in it spins but all the way out it does not have various pry bars and newest try was slide hammer with a claw (cv boot removal tool) that i thought would be perfect no luck the fact that it spins is what is confusing why does it come out 1/2 in but not the rest of the way. serious pressure applied.

Did you have the axle removed from the transmission and the spindle attached at the ball joint to the control arm when you were trying to pull it out with a come a along ??
Have you soaked those splines down some penetrating oil like PB Blaster ??
Have you tried to beat it out with a big hammer or sledge, again was the axle still in the trans or did you have it free of the transmission ??

For what most axles cost (45-60 bucks) I'm all for just doing the axle and then it's almost always warrantied if the boot or joint fail in the future. That compared to taking it out, taking it apart, cleaning out all the grease, replacing the joint and or boot, re-assembly, re-greasing and re-install ??

Pry bars on both sides would be my preference. It really does not take much force, but maybe if there is not good lubrication in there, the spring ring doesn't want to cooperate.
